Story
!!Meet Hobbes!! After meeting with multiple applicants and even being adopted briefly, we've discovered that while people find Hobbes adorable, we may need to clarify a few things a bit more strongly. Hobbes was surrendered after spending his first year in a home that offered little structure or attention. He was part of a litter meant to be sold by a casual breeder, then left behind with an elderly family member when it wasn't as easy as they thought it would be. Hobbes had never even been given a name during that first year. Despite his beginning, he's a very intelligent and affectionate dog who gets along so well with all other animals. He will need a home committed to continuing normal training and socialization though. And he may take time to warm up to new people. Due to his young age, Hobbes has his active spurts (zoomies), but also LOVES couch time next to his human friends. While he's inherently a very good natured dog, he is nervous with strangers and can remain that way until he gets to know someone. He is completely worth the time and warms up quickly, but an effort has to be put forth to get to that step. His first experience with housetraining, walking with a leash on, and meaningful interaction with people began in his foster home about two months ago. Hobbes picked up leash walking quickly, but will still run circles around you and get his leash twisted up, which may in turn startle him. He is picking up housetraining, but will still have accidents in the house if his cue isn't noticed right away. ** The biggest impediment to his adoption though, is that he experiences separation anxiety when left kenneled and he knows people are home. His reaction to being without humans is constant barking which will resolve after about 15 minutes, until he realizes people are back home. This can become an issue quickly in an apartment or situation where neighbors are close. A new home would have to continue to work with him. Lastly, Hoobes is a Shih Tzu mix. He looks like a Shih, but with longer legs and a longer body. His coat will need periodic grooming (4 times a year minimum) and he may need a mild sedative from his veterinarian prior to each appointment until he becomes more comfortable with it all. He is neutered, heartworm tested and vaccinated. Appointments to meet him will be scheduled for those who apply to adopt him once it's established the home may be a good fit for him.
